My US citizen spouse filed a petition for me, but we're getting divorced. Can I still get a green card, and what are the implications for my immigration status?

If your US citizen spouse filed a petition for you, but you're getting divorced, it may impact your immigration status. You may need to file a waiver or provide evidence of good faith marriage.
